      Explain any three strategies adopted by the government to protect the interest of the consumers.            

    Answer:

                      Following are the strategies adopted by the government to protect the interest of the consumers (i) Enactment of COPRA Under this Act, a three-tier judicial machinery at the district, state and national levels was set up for redressal of consumer disputes. The Act enables the consumers to represent them in consumer courts. (ii) RTI Act, In October 2005, the Government of India enacted Right to Information Act (RTI) which ensures the citizens all the information about the functions of government departments and people can ask and make complaints on issues like bad roads, poor water and health facilities, government jobs and their status etc. (iii) Standardisation of the Products There are organisations like ISI, Ag mark or Hallmark which develop quality standards for many products. They provide logos and certificates that help consumers get assured of quality while purchasing the goods and services.
